Elyse Wanshel

Elyse Wanshel is an award-winning journalist, based in New York City. She is currently a reporter for HuffPost, where she covers disability, culture, social issues, entertainment, crime and the occasional cute cat or dog. Elyse previously worked as a humor columnist for the Miami New Times.
